Output 265324200ea854d9636feb67ad8201588ee5b4b406a15eb662b7a3507cd02c34:0
- value
- 450400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66abfac5353aabb38b14e7a05631f5dc9cc29278 OP_EQUAL
- address
- 3B3tsTfebnZJbY7W9BbBuUhxA5yk2CbHTA
- transaction
- 265324200ea854d9636feb67ad8201588ee5b4b406a15eb662b7a3507cd02c34
- confirmations
- 339768
- spent
- true